Abstract
A folding collapsible storage container includes a folding container body formed by stitching cloth-wrapped rigid members together and having horizontal pockets on the inside, a first partition strip set between two opposite side panels of the container body with its two folding ends respectively plugged into a respective horizontal pocket at the associating side panels of the container body, and second partition strips bilaterally set between the other two opposite side panels of the container body and the two opposite sides of the first partition strip with their respective two folding ends respectively plugged into a respective horizontal pocket at the associating side panel of the container body and a respective horizontal pocket at the first partition strip.
Description
- (a) Technical Field of the Invention
- The present invention relates to storage containers and more particularly, to a folding collapsible storage container that can be folded into a collapsed flat manner to reduce storage space.
- (b) Description of the Prior Art
- Due to limited living space, people usually use storage containers to keep small clothes and small items. Conventional storage containers are made of rigid materials such as plastics, wood, metal, etc. These rigid storage containers are not collapsible. Therefore, these rigid storage containers require much storage space when not in use or during delivery. Nowadays, various folding collapsible storage containers have been disclosed, and have appeared on the market. A folding collapsible storage container is known comprising a collapsible rectangular container body formed of canvass, four top horizontal rods respectively fastened to the four sides of the container body at the top, two bottom horizontal axis respectively fastened to two opposite sides of the container body at the bottom, and four vertical rods respectively fastened to the container body in the four corners. The rod members am kept spaced from one another at a distance after installation. The rod members support the container body in shape. Further, each vertical peripheral panel of the container body has two crossed and diagonally extending folding lines. Through the folding lines, the container body can be collapsed.
- Conventional folding collapsible storage containers have fixed compartments. The user cannot adjust the number of the compartments subject to actual requirements.
- The primary purpose of the present invention is to provide a folding collapsible storage container that can conveniently be set up for storing storage items in a good order, or folded into a collapsed flat manner to save storage space when not in use. It is another object of foe present invention to provide a folding collapsible storage container, which allows foe user to adjust the number of compartments defined in the container body.
- According to one aspect of the present invention, the folding collapsible storage container comprises a folding container body which is formed by stitching cloth-wrapped rigid member together and has horizontal pockets on the inside, a rigid bottom plain attached to the flexible bottom panel of the folding container body, and a first partition strip set between two opposite side panels of the container body with its two folding ends respectively plugged into a respective horizontal pocket at the associating side panels of the container body to divide the accommodation open space of the container body into two compartments. A tier removable of foe rigid bottom plate and the first partition strip from the folding container body the folding container body can be folded into a collapsed flat manner.
- According to another aspect of the present invention, second partition strips are provided and bilaterally set between the other two opposite side panels of the container body and the two opposite sides of the first partition strip with their respective two folding ends respectively plugged into a respective horizontal pocket at rite associating side panel of the container body and a respective horizontal pocket at the first partition strip. Therefore, the second partition strips divide the two compartments into multiple small compartments.
- According to still another aspect of the present invention, the side panels of the container body, the first partition strip, and the second partition strips are respectively wrapped with a cloth member and stitched to provide the respective horizontal pockets.

- Referring to
FIG. 1 , a folding collapsible storage container in accordance with the present invention is shown comprised of acontainer body 1, a rigid bottom plate 2, at least onefirst partition strip 3, and at least one second partition strip 4. - The
container body 1 is a rectangular box member formed by stitching cloth-wrapped rigid plate members together, comprising a bottom panel 11 and fourside panels 12 perpendicularly arranged around the four sides of the bottom panel 11. The bottom panel 11 is a soft cloth panel without rigid plain member. The fourside panels 12 are respectively formed of at least one cloth wrapped rigid plate member. Avertical trading line 121 is formed on the middle of each of two opposite ones of the fourside panels 12 so that thecontainer body 1 can be folded into a flat manner. Eachside panel 12 carrying onefolding line 121 is formed of two cloth-wrapped rigid plate members, and thefolding line 121 is disposed between the two rigid plate members. Thecontainer body 1 defines an accommodation open space. Further, two handles 14 are provided at twoopposite side panels 12 outside thecontainer body 1 for carrying by hand. - Further,
horizontal pockets 131 are provided on the inner sides of theside panels 12 for securing thefirst partition strips 3 and the second partition strips 4. - Each
first partition strip 3 is formed of a big cloth-wrappedrigid strip member 32, two small cloth-wrappedrigid strip members 31, and twofolding lines 33 respectively connected to between the two distal ends of the big cloth-wrappedrigid strip member 32 and the two small cloth-wrappedrigid strip members 31. By means of thefolding lines 33, the two small cloth-wrappedrigid strip members 31 can be respectively turned inwards through 90-degrees relative to the big cloth-wrapped rigid stop member 32 (seeFIG. 2 ). Further, thefirst partition strip 3 has a plurality ofhorizontal pockets 321 symmetrically disposed at two opposite sides corresponding to thehorizontal pockets 131 on twoopposite side panels 12 of thecontainer body 1. - Each second partition strip 4 is formed of a big cloth-wrapped
rigid strip member 41, two small cloth-wrappedrigid strip members 42, and two folding lines 43 respectively connected to between the two distal ends of the big cloth-wrappedrigid strip member 41 and the two small cloth-wrappedrigid strip members 42. By means of the folding lines 43, the two small cloth-wrappedrigid strip members 42 can be respectively turned inwards through 90-degrees relative to the big cloth-wrapped rigid strip member 41 (seeFIG. 2 ). - During installation, the rigid bottom plate 2 is mounted in the
container body 1 and closely attached to the top side of the bottom panel 11, and thefirst partition strips 3 and the second partition strips 4 are selectively mounted in thecontainer body 1 to divide the accommodation open space of thecontainer body 1 into a plurality of compartments. -
FIG. 3 shows one installation example of the folding collapsible storage container in which onefirst partition strip 3 is installed in thecontainer body 1 to divide the accommodation open space of thecontainer body 1 into two compartments. According to this installation example, the two small cloth-wrappedrigid strip members 31 of thefirst partition strip 3 are respectively inserted into a respectivehorizontal pocket 131 of twoopposite side panels 13 of thecontainer body 1 and the big cloth-wrappedrigid strip member 32 is stopped between the two associatingopposite side panels 13 of the container body 1 (see alsoFIG. 2 ). -
FIG. 4 corresponds toFIG. 3 but showing two second partition strips 4 installed in thecontainer body 1, and thefirst partition strip 3 with the two second partition strips 4 divide the accommodation open space of thecontainer body 1 into four compartments, the two small cloth-wrappedrigid strip members 42 of each second partition strip 4 are respectively fastened to onehorizontal pocket 321 of thefirst partition strip 3 and onehorizontal pocket 131 of oneside panel 12 of the container body 1 (see alsoFIG. 2 ). -
FIG. 5 shows still another installation example of the fording collapsible storage container in which onefirst partition strip 3 and tour second partition strips 4 are installed in thecontainer body 1 to divide the accommodation open space of thecontainer body 1 into 6 compartments. -
FIG. 6 shows still another installation example of the folding collapsible storage container in which twofirst partition strips 3 and 6 second partition strips 4 are installed in thecontainer body 1 to divide the accommodation open space of thecontainer body 1 into 9 compartments. - Referring to
FIG. 7 , when not in use, thefirst partition strips 3 and the second partition strips 4 can be received together in a stack or stacks, and thecontainer body 1 can be folded into a flat manner after removal of the rigid bottom plate 2 (not shown). - In the aforesaid embodiment, the folding collapsible storage container is a rectangular storage container. Claims (3)
1. A folding collapsible storage container comprising:
a container body, said container body comprising a flexible bottom panel, and four rigid side panels perpendicularly arranged around four sides of said flexible bottom panel and defining with said flexible bottom panel a rectangular accommodation open space, said side panels each having and inner side and at least one horizontal pocket at the inner side, said side panels including two first opposite side panels, said first opposite side panels each having a vertically extending middle folding line;
a rigid bottom plate attachable to said flexible bottom panel inside said container body; and
at least one first partition strip for fastening to said container body to divide said rectangular accommodation open space into a plurality of compartments, said at least one first partition strip comprising a big rigid strip member, two small rigid strip members respectively connected to two distal ends of said big rigid strip member for plugging into one horizontal pocket of each of two opposite side panels of said container body, and two folding lines respectively connected to between the two distal ends of said big rigid strip member and said two small rigid strip members.
2. The folding collapsible storage container as claimed in claim 1 , further comprising a plurality of second partition strips for fastening to two opposite side panels of said container body and two opposite sides of each of said at least one first partition strip that is fastened to said container body, said second partition strips each comprising a first rigid strip member, two second rigid strip members respectively connected to two distal ends of said first rigid strip member for plugging into one horizontal pocket of one side panel of said container body and one horizontal pocket of said at least one first partition strip, and two folding lines respectively connected to between the two distal ends of said first rigid strip member and said two second rigid strip members.
3. The folding collapsible storage container as claimed in claim 1 , wherein said side panels of said container body and said at least one first partition strip are respectively wrapped with a cloth member and stitched to provide the respective horizontal pockets.
